  Comparative analysis of venom composition, enzymatic activity, and antivenom immunorecognition in neonates of four Bothrops species Abstract This study compared venom composition, enzymatic activities, and antivenom immunorecognition in neonates from three Bothrops clades. Results suggest potential clade-specific markers in electrophoretic profiles and phospholipase-A 2 and L-amino acid oxidase enzymatic activities. These findings suggest that neonate venom traits may serve as auxiliary parameters for taxonomic differentiation, though further research is needed to account for individual and sexual variability. A new record of genus Brignoliolus Ovtchinnikov from Türkiye (Araneae: Agelenidae)

ABSTRACT

The species Brignoliolus caudatus Blauwe, 1973 (♀) has been recorded for the first time in Türkiye. Also, this represents the first record outside of its type locality. Detailed descriptions, photographs, and a distribution map of Brignoliolus caudatus Blauwe, 1973 (♀) are provided. Additionally, other species belonging to the genus Brignoliolus in Türkiye is also mapped.
